Frage

Ich bin ziemlich neu in SubSonic und heruntergeladen die neueste Version, die nur eine ZIP-Datei mit den Ordnern Binaries, Beispielen und T4-Vorlagen enthalten. Bei der weiteren Lektüre war ich gespannt auf die Gerüst Kontrolle versucht, aber die DLL keine Werkzeuge enthalten, die die VS2008 Toolbox hinzufügen.

Ich bin auch nicht in der Lage zu verwenden .Fetch, .FetchByID, etc.

Ich bin mit dem Active Record, und alle Tabellen Entitäten in ActiveRecord.cs erstellt.

Ich kann Daten unter Verwendung des folgenden greifen:


        var qry = from s in tbl_Geo_State.All()
                  select new
                  {
                      s.State
                  };

        GridView1.DataSource = qry;
        GridView1.DataBind();

Gibt es eine andere Installationsdatei für 3.0.x.x oder sollte ich eine ältere Version installieren (wenn ja, welche), und einfach die neuen Verzeichnisse der Installation hinzufügen, um die Werkzeuge zu bekommen und fehlende Methoden?

Danke.

War es hilfreich?

Lösung

Haben müssen nicht den Scaffold aktualisieren - es funktioniert super, wie es ist :). Ich werde das „web stuff“ in separate DLLs werden Aufspalten, wenn ich eine Chance haben -. Aber jetzt können Sie sowohl 3 und 2 im selben Projekt verwenden, wenn Sie, dass die Kontrolle wollen

RE Fetch und fetchByID - das sind statische Factory-Methoden auf die Klasse:

Product.SingleOrDefault(...)
Product.Find(...)
Product.All().Where()...

etc.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top